Seth Godin on “Standing Out”

Thought-provoking video here from Seth Godin on an alternative to the traditional ideas and methods of Marketing. His main idea: “Those that can spread ideas… win.”

Nowadays consumers have so many choices that ignoring messages is extremely common. Godin suggests that companies should stop just communicating the facts, features and benefits about their own products or services, and rather, ought to put out messages and ideas that actually interest their consumers. Determine what people really want to hear and know, and put forth ideas that are new and fresh (and not boring). Doing so, according to Godin, will dictate what ideas spread, and in turn, what gets selected, what gets purchased and what gets built. According to Godin, the process is no longer about who buys the most advertising or even who makes the best product- it’s about who is the most interesting. It’s now about marketing in a fashion age and spreading ideas to those who find you interesting and those who care about and see value in your message.
